Virtual Assistant (VA) Hiring and what they can do for you.

Many of us want to move our business forward.  Most of us need to focus on the tasks that make us money.  We all need to be doing things that result (hopefully) in the highest and best use of our time (like listing deals or playing golf).  Tasks that may be repetitive in nature or doing things that we may not be as good at should be done by somebody else.  This is where you need to delegate.  Yes, you can delegate to someone in the U.S; but I prefer the Phillipines.  I use this site.

It costs about $89 or $99 per month (depending on what you want), but I only use it for 1 month.  That's all you'll need it for.  You should easily find who you are looking for in that time frame.  Why do I use them?  Well, they happen to be very loyal and good at what you're hiring them for.  They're used to working for foreignors and they work for a fraction of what a U.S. worker will work for.  You can find someone to do anything.  They can create websites, do SEO, content writing, answer emails, data mining, cold calling anything that you can think of.  

Do they always work out for you?  No, they don't.  Neither do people you hire in the U.S.  Most of the time they do though.  I have 3 VA's right now.  My total outlay for the first month is going to be $1,250.  Remember, this is for the month, not the week and a total of 480 hours of work.  What can you do with lots of time?
